How to make a permanant variable
#1

Hello. How do I make it so when someone uses /createhouse it adds one more onto the id variable, but when I restart the server, the id variable goes back to 0.

pawn Код:
stock CreateHouse(price, Float:PosX, Float:PosY, Float:PosZ)
{
    new string[140], query[300];
    new id = 0; // Here is the ID variable. I want it to save even on game mode restart

    HouseInfo[id][hHouseID] = id;
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][0] = PosX;
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][1] = PosY;
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][2] = PosZ;
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][0] = 266.9708;
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][1] = 304.9378;
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][2] = 999.1484;
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][3] = 273.4171;
    HouseInfo[id][hInterior] = 2;
    format(HouseInfo[id][hAddress], 32, "1 San Fierro Drive");
    HouseInfo[id][hPrice] = price;

    format(query, sizeof(query), "INSERT INTO `Houses` (`HouseID`, `Address`, `Price`, `EnterX`, `EnterY`, `EnterZ`, `ExitX`, `ExitY`, `ExitZ`, `ExitA`, `Interior`) VALUES (%d, \'%s\', %d, %f, %f, %f, %f, %f, %f, %f, %d)",
    HouseInfo[id][hHouseID],
    HouseInfo[id][hAddress],
    HouseInfo[id][hPrice],
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][0],
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][1],
    HouseInfo[id][hEnterPos][2],
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][0],
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][1],
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][2],
    HouseInfo[id][hExitPos][3],
    HouseInfo[id][hInterior]
    );

    mysql_function_query(g_Handle, query, false, "", "");

    HouseInfo[id][hPickup] = CreateDynamicPickup(1273, 23, PosX, PosY, PosZ, -1, -1, -1, 100.0);
    format(string,sizeof(string),"HouseID: %d\nAddress: %s\nPrice: %d", HouseInfo[id][hHouseID], HouseInfo[id][hAddress], HouseInfo[id][hPrice]);
    HouseInfo[id][hText] = CreateDynamic3DTextLabel(string, -1, PosX, PosY, PosZ, 25, INVALID_PLAYER_ID, INVALID_VEHICLE_ID, 1, -1, -1, -1, 100);
    id ++; // Here it adds one on each time a house is created
}
